Fact Check: Joe Biden, 81, (Again) Claims He ‘Used to Drive an 18-Wheeler‘
Breitbart | 04/25/2024 | WENDELL HUSEBØCLAIM: President Joe Biden recently aired his oft-repeated claim he “used to drive an 18-wheeler.”
VERDICT: False.
“Biden’s claim remains untrue. There is no evidence he ever drove an 18-wheeler,” CNN reported Wednesday:
Biden has repeatedly embellished or invented biographical tidbits. In 2021, he claimed during a tour of a Mack Trucks facility: “I used to drive an 18-wheeler, man,” then added, “I got to.” At a separate 2021 event, he told college students studying truck technology, “I used to drive a tractor-trailer,” adding, “I only did it for part of a summer, but I got my license anyway.”
Biden’s claims were fact-checked at the time as false. But on Tuesday, during a campaign event in Florida, Biden said it again.
